Another salient aspect of al-Jafari’s teachings pertains to the cultivation of ethical virtues. His discourse on the moral character reflects a belief that ethical behavior serves as the bedrock of an individual’s spiritual ascension. Al-Jafari articulated that virtues such as honesty, compassion, and humility are paramount in the journey toward divine proximity. The allegory of a compass aptly illustrates this concept—where moral virtues guide the believer through the tumultuous seas of life, ensuring that each decision aligns with the true north of divine will.
